fun fact: this is a shape memory alloy (SMA) and as you can tell from the video, it can be bent in different ways and go back to its original state when hit with heat. this is also actually how braces work! the wire is made from an SMA and bends around your teeth and uses the heat from your mouth to shift the wire to its original state and make your teeth to be straighter.
edit: for anyone wondering, the metal is called nitinol

Did you know the Name NiTiNOL came from the Elements it was created and the NationalOrdnanceLabratory where it was created so they named it NiTiNOL
